UNLZH version 1.7 - A program for extracting .LZH archive files.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
UNLZH combines an easy to use, GEM based interface with high speed&lt;br /&gt;
extraction routines, to give you a much simpler and much faster way to&lt;br /&gt;
extract LZH archives.  It is a self contained program - you do not need&lt;br /&gt;
to have LHARC or any 'shell'.  It is written in 100% Assembly language,&lt;br /&gt;
and extracts approximately four times faster than LHARC.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
UNLZH can search past damaged sections of an archive, and should be able&lt;br /&gt;
to extract the rest of the files.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
UNLZH can also extract multiple archives at once, and place the contents&lt;br /&gt;
in individual folders.&lt;br /&gt;

How to Use the Program:&lt;br /&gt;
-----------------------&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
UNLZH will start with a menu screen that contains configuration options,&lt;br /&gt;
and all the main functions.  In the upper part of the menu are two program&lt;br /&gt;
options that should be set up before selecting any of the function buttons&lt;br /&gt;
in the lower part.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The first option, Create Folders, can be used if you want the program to&lt;br /&gt;
create a folder with the same name as the archive file, and place all the&lt;br /&gt;
extracted contents within it.  If you want to extract directly to the&lt;br /&gt;
destination path, select 'No' for the Create Folders option.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
When the second option, Overwrite Files, is set to 'No', the program will&lt;br /&gt;
prompt you if one of the files to be extracted already exists.  (Similar&lt;br /&gt;
to the warning the GEM desktop gives you when you try to copy a file that&lt;br /&gt;
already exists).  Selecting 'Yes' for this option will bypass the warning&lt;br /&gt;
prompt, and overwrite any files that may have already existed.&lt;br /&gt;

Program Functions:&lt;br /&gt;
------------------&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
- Extract -&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The first, and default function is to Extract all.  This will prompt you&lt;br /&gt;
for an input archive file, then a destination path, and then extract all&lt;br /&gt;
the files from the archive.  If the Create Folders option is turned on,&lt;br /&gt;
a folder will be created at the destination path, and the files will be&lt;br /&gt;
extracted into it.  If a folder by that name already exists, the program&lt;br /&gt;
will extract into the already existing folder.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
To extract multiple archives at once, just enter an '*' for the input&lt;br /&gt;
filename.  UNLZH will then extract all of the archives in that directory.&lt;br /&gt;
You should have the Create Folders option turned on, so that the archives&lt;br /&gt;
will extract into separate folders.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
- W/Query -&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Extract With Query operates the same as the full Extract, except that&lt;br /&gt;
after selecting the input archive file, another menu will come up which&lt;br /&gt;
displays all of the files contained in the archive.  You may click on&lt;br /&gt;
individual files to select them, or hold the left mouse button down and&lt;br /&gt;
drag the pointer over a group of files.  Files selected for extraction are&lt;br /&gt;
indicated by having an '*' placed in front of the file name.  Files may&lt;br /&gt;
also be deselected in the same way.  When you have selected all the&lt;br /&gt;
desired files, click on the Extract button.  The ALL button is a short&lt;br /&gt;
cut, in case you decide you want all the files after all, and don't want&lt;br /&gt;
to select them all manually.  You can also click on Quit, which will&lt;br /&gt;
return you to the initial menu.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
If the archive file has been damaged, some of the selections may display as&lt;br /&gt;
'- Bad Header -'.  These sections cannot be extracted, however UNLZH will&lt;br /&gt;
search the rest of the archive to find as many good files as possible.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
- To Screen -&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Extract to Screen also displays a menu of the archive contents.  Some files&lt;br /&gt;
may already be selected for extraction.  Any file beginning with READ, or&lt;br /&gt;
having the extension .TXT, .DOC, or .ASC, will be marked.  Also, if there&lt;br /&gt;
is only one file in the archive, it will be marked to extract.  If you wish&lt;br /&gt;
to extract the pre-selected files, you can immediately select the Screen or&lt;br /&gt;
Printer option at the bottom of the menu.  Otherwise, you may manually&lt;br /&gt;
select which file(s) you want to look at in the same manner as described for&lt;br /&gt;
Extract with Query.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
A maximum of 3 files will be marked, except in cases where the archive&lt;br /&gt;
contains all text files, in which case none of the files will be pre-marked.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Screen listings will pause every 24 lines.  (Or more if you are using a&lt;br /&gt;
larger screen).  There are many options to control the screen listing:&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Left Mouse Button - Continue listing one line at a time&lt;br /&gt;
Right Mouse Button - Reverse scroll the listing, one line at a time&lt;br /&gt;
Both Buttons - Abort listing&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
'Return' - Display one line at a time&lt;br /&gt;
'Down Arrow' or 'Space Bar' - Display one screen at a time&lt;br /&gt;
'Up Arrow' - Back up to the previous screen&lt;br /&gt;
'Shift' &amp;amp; 'Down Arrow' - Jump 4 screens forward&lt;br /&gt;
'Shift' &amp;amp; 'Up Arrow' - Jump 4 screens backward&lt;br /&gt;
'Home' - Return to the top of the file&lt;br /&gt;
'S' - Enter Search and Move menu:&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
      To perform a search, enter a phrase to search for, and select whether&lt;br /&gt;
      the program should 'Match', or 'Ignore' differences in upper/lower&lt;br /&gt;
      case.  Then click on either 'Search' or 'Next' to begin searching.&lt;br /&gt;
      (You may also press the 'Return' key for the Next function).&lt;br /&gt;
      'Search' will start at the top of the file, and 'Next' will start at&lt;br /&gt;
      the current location.  The program will display the next line that&lt;br /&gt;
      contains the search phrase.  If no match was found, the display will&lt;br /&gt;
      be in the same place, and the Bell will sound.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
      The other buttons allow you to jump directly to one of five positions.&lt;br /&gt;
      'Top' jumps to the top of the file.  (Same as Home)&lt;br /&gt;
      '1/4' jumps to a position one quarter of the way through the file&lt;br /&gt;
      '1/2' jumps to half way through the file&lt;br /&gt;
      '3/4' jumps three quarters of the way through&lt;br /&gt;
      'End' jumps to the end of the file&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
'N' - Display the 'Next' match, using the current search phrase&lt;br /&gt;
'P' - Send a block of text to the Printer:&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
      The first 'P' will mark the top line of the current screen as the top&lt;br /&gt;
      of the block.  Then move down to the end of the area you wish to print,&lt;br /&gt;
      and press 'P' again.  This will send all of the text from your first&lt;br /&gt;
      mark, to the bottom line of the ending screen, to the printer.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
'D' - Send a block of text to a disk file.  This works the same as the 'P'&lt;br /&gt;
      function, except you will get a GEM file selector to enter a name for&lt;br /&gt;
      the text file to write the block to.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Press 'ESC' to abort either screen or printer listings.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
If multiple files were selected for extraction, Abort will progress to the&lt;br /&gt;
next file.  This, combined with the search capabitities, allows you to&lt;br /&gt;
search multiple files very easily.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Notes: In low memory situations, where there is not enough room to store&lt;br /&gt;
the entire extracted file, the process is done in segments, and there are a&lt;br /&gt;
few differences in the way the program responds.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Backing up the display is limited to how much of the extracted file is still&lt;br /&gt;
in memory.  You may find a point where you can't back up any further.  This&lt;br /&gt;
is because the data before this point has been overwritten.  This&lt;br /&gt;
restriction does not occur with the Home, Search, and Jump functions, and&lt;br /&gt;
they may be used to get back to earlier sections of the file.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
After a search where a match is not found, the program will try to return&lt;br /&gt;
to the previous location.  If that spot is no longer in memory, the program&lt;br /&gt;
will jump to the top of the file.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
When using the Print Block feature, you may be scrolling the file across one&lt;br /&gt;
of the segment boundaries.  If this happens the program will immediately&lt;br /&gt;
send all the data so far, out to the printer.  The scrolling process will be&lt;br /&gt;
paused until the data has been sent.  Afterwards, you can continue scrolling&lt;br /&gt;
to the desired end position, and press 'P' to print the rest of the data.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Again, unless you operate the program in low memory situations, and/or&lt;br /&gt;
extract large text files, you will not see any of these behaviors.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
- Test -&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The Test function is used to test the files in an archive without actually&lt;br /&gt;
extracting any of them.  It will display 'Okay' after each valid file, and&lt;br /&gt;
report any problems found in the archive.  It operates like Extract with&lt;br /&gt;
Query, but does not ask you for a destination path, (as it does not write&lt;br /&gt;
out any extracted files).&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
- View -&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
View allows you to look at all the files in an archive.  It will ask for&lt;br /&gt;
an input archive file, and then display an options menu.  You should first&lt;br /&gt;
select either Verbose or Short format.  Short will list only the filenames,&lt;br /&gt;
original sizes, and any comments the archive contains.  The Verbose form&lt;br /&gt;
lists the following information about all of the files.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Filename:  The name of the original file.&lt;br /&gt;
Actual:    The size of the original file.&lt;br /&gt;
Packed:    The size of the compressed file.&lt;br /&gt;
Ratio:     The compressed file size as compared to the original.&lt;br /&gt;
Time/Date: The time and date when the file was last modified.&lt;br /&gt;
Attr:      The following letters will be displayed if the corresponding&lt;br /&gt;
           file attribute is set:&lt;br /&gt;
           r - File is set to Read Only&lt;br /&gt;
           h - File is hidden from directories&lt;br /&gt;
           s - System file&lt;br /&gt;
           a - Archive bit.&lt;br /&gt;
Methd:     The method used in storing the file.  Either '-lh1-' for a&lt;br /&gt;
           compressed file, or '-lh0-' for uncompressed&lt;br /&gt;
CRC        The CRC calculation of file.  This value is recalculated&lt;br /&gt;
           whenever the file is extracted, to test if the file is Okay.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
You can also select whether the output will be displayed on the screen,&lt;br /&gt;
sent to the printer, or sent to a disk file.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The screen display will pause every 24 lines.  You may press 'Space Bar' to&lt;br /&gt;
continue, 'Return' or Left Mouse Button to list one line at a time, 'Home'&lt;br /&gt;
to return to the top of the list, and 'ESC' or Both Mouse Buttons to abort.&lt;br /&gt;
Backing up is not supported.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
If you enter '*' for the input filename, UNLZH will create a listing of all&lt;br /&gt;
the archives in the directory, separated by the names of the archives&lt;br /&gt;
themselves.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
- Quit -&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Quit will exit to the desktop.&lt;br /&gt;

Saving the Configuration:&lt;br /&gt;
-------------------------&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The 'Save Configuration' button will save the current settings for all of&lt;br /&gt;
the program options, (including Short/Verbose listing and Match/Ignore&lt;br /&gt;
cases), plus the input and output path names that were last used.  The&lt;br /&gt;
information will be written directly into the program file itself.  If&lt;br /&gt;
UNLZH17.PRG cannot be found on the default directory, the program will ask&lt;br /&gt;
you to enter its location using the file selector.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Do not attempt to save a configuration into an UNLZH program file that has&lt;br /&gt;
been modified in any way.  If you have used a compression program such as&lt;br /&gt;
'PACK' on the UNLZH17.PRG file, you MUST uncompress the file before saving&lt;br /&gt;
any configurations.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The Overwrite Warning Message:&lt;br /&gt;
------------------------------&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Anytime UNLZH finds that an extracted file already exists at the&lt;br /&gt;
destination, it will display a warning message with several choices.&lt;br /&gt;
(Unless you have the program option Overwrite Files set to 'Yes').&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
You may press the 'Return' key, or click on 'Extract' to overwrite the&lt;br /&gt;
file.  You may also change the name of the extracted file to something&lt;br /&gt;
else, and press return.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The 'Skip' button will skip the current file without extracting it, and&lt;br /&gt;
continue with the rest of the archive.  The file will also be skipped if&lt;br /&gt;
you press the 'Esc' key to erase the name, and then press 'Return'.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The 'All' button will extract all of the files in the current archive&lt;br /&gt;
without any more warning prompts.  When the archive has been extracted&lt;br /&gt;
completely, the warning prompt will be active again in case you are doing&lt;br /&gt;
multiple archives.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The 'Quit' button will skip the rest of the files in the current archive.&lt;br /&gt;
If you are extracting multiple archives, it will go on to the next one.&lt;br /&gt;
Otherwise, 'Quit' will return to the main menu.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Files set to Read-Only  (Protected Files)&lt;br /&gt;
----------------------&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
You will also get a warning message if the existing file is set to Read&lt;br /&gt;
Only.  The prompt will indicate that the file is protected, and give you&lt;br /&gt;
the same choices as the File Overwrite warning.  Note: The Read Only&lt;br /&gt;
warning will always be active, regardless of the setting for the Overwrite&lt;br /&gt;
Files option.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
UNLZH as a GEM application:&lt;br /&gt;
---------------------------&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
In addition to running normally from the desktop, UNLZH can be installed&lt;br /&gt;
as a GEM application with a document type LZH.  This allows you to double-&lt;br /&gt;
click on any .LZH archive, and automatically load in the UNLZH program.&lt;br /&gt;
You can still select options from the main menu.  When you select a&lt;br /&gt;
program function, you will not be asked for an input file.  Instead, UNLZH&lt;br /&gt;
will use the .LZH file you double-clicked on as its input.  Also, when the&lt;br /&gt;
operation is completed, the program will exit to the desktop, instead of&lt;br /&gt;
returning to the main menu.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
To Install:  (From the GEM Desktop)&lt;br /&gt;
-----------&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
If you have previously installed an application for .LZH files, you will&lt;br /&gt;
need to remove it.  Click once on the previous program to highlight it.&lt;br /&gt;
Select 'Install Application' from the Options drop down menu.  Then click&lt;br /&gt;
on the Remove button.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
To install UNLZH, click once on UNLZH17.PRG, select 'Install Application'&lt;br /&gt;
from the drop down menu, enter 'LZH' as the document type, and then click&lt;br /&gt;
on the Install button.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
You should then save the desktop, also using the options drop down menu.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Command Lines:&lt;br /&gt;
--------------&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
There is limited support for calling UNLZH from a command line.  It will&lt;br /&gt;
take the filename from command input, and do a full extract on the output&lt;br /&gt;
path that was saved with the configuration.  (If the configuration has not&lt;br /&gt;
been saved, files will be written to the default directory).  Full pathname&lt;br /&gt;
inputs are allowed, and wildcards can be used for batch processing.  The&lt;br /&gt;
'Create Folders' and 'Overwrite Files' options have the same effects.  The&lt;br /&gt;
program will exit after completion, or after any errors.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
To bypass the main menu and other GEM prompts, enter an 'X ' in front of&lt;br /&gt;
the input file.  (i.e. 'UNLZH X FILENAME' as in ARC.TTP).&lt;br /&gt;
